📅  最后修改于: 2023-12-03 15:10:57.673000             🧑  作者: Mango
随着计算机技术的不断发展,我们越来越多地使用计算机进行交易、通讯以及存储个人信息。而这些操作也带来了许多新的安全问题,如身份欺诈以及私人信息泄漏等。因此,欺诈预防和隐私保护逐渐成为了信息技术领域的热点问题。
欺诈预防和隐私保护不仅是需要程序员的技术支持,更是需要法律和制度的支撑。各个国家和地区对于欺诈预防和隐私保护也都有相应的法律规定。
欺诈预防是指在交易过程中防止欺诈行为的发生。欺诈行为包括了虚假交易、信用卡盗刷、非法转账等行为。以下是一些欺诈预防的技术措施:
双因素认证:在进行敏感操作时,需要用户提供多种身份验证方式,如密码和手机验证码等。
日志监控:对于系统的日志进行监控,及时发现异常操作。
机器学习:通过机器学习对于用户行为模式进行分析和判断,判断是否存在欺诈行为。
隐私保护是指在信息处理过程中,保护个人隐私信息不被滥用或泄露。以下是一些隐私保护的技术措施:
数据加密:对于存储的个人信息进行加密处理,提高数据的安全性。
匿名化处理:对于一些不必要的个人信息(如姓名、生日等),进行匿名化处理,以保护用户隐私。
最小化信息收集:只收集必要的个人信息,避免过度收集造成的信息泄露风险。
不同国家和地区的法律法规不尽相同,以下是一些欺诈预防和隐私保护的法律法规:
欧洲《一般数据保护条例》(GDPR):规定了个人信息处理的流程、义务和责任。
美国《电子通信隐私法》(ECPA):保护电子通讯服务提供商的隐私权。
中国《网络安全法》:规定了个人信息保护的相关内容。
欺诈预防和隐私保护是程序员在开发过程中需要考虑的重要问题。同时,也需要我们遵守各国家和地区的相关法律法规,保护个人隐私信息,建立信任的交易环境。